Additional information

Issued to mark the 350th anniversary of the crowning of the Levočská Madona as a miraculous image, this coin commemorates one of the most enduring pilgrimage sites in Central Europe. The wooden Gothic statue in the Basilica of St. James in Levoča has drawn pilgrims since the 14th century, and the formal coronation ceremony of 1653 — conducted under Archbishop Juraj Lippay — elevated its official status within the Catholic Church.

Levoča itself was a dominant trading hub of the medieval Kingdom of Hungary, a history reflected in the exceptional craftsmanship still visible throughout the town's preserved architecture. Slovakia's post-independence commemorative program has leaned heavily on such regional religious and cultural touchstones.
